diff --git a/Plugins/Wox.Plugin.Program/Programs/Win32.cs b/Plugins/Wox.Plugin.Program/Programs/Win32.cs index 3d7e3fe16c..316820c997 100644 --- a/Plugins/Wox.Plugin.Program/Programs/Win32.cs +++ b/Plugins/Wox.Plugin.Program/Programs/Win32.cs @@ -299,6 +299,7 @@ namespace Wox.Plugin.Program.Programs var paths = toFilter .Where(t1 => !disabledProgramsList.Any(x => x.UniqueIdentifier == t1)) .Select(t1 => t1) + .Distinct() .ToArray(); var programs1 = paths.AsParallel().Where(p => Extension(p) == ShortcutExtension).Select(LnkProgram);